Huffington Post (USA)
Greater education about contraception is directly correlated to a decrease in risky sexual behavior among young adults, according to a new study. But when researchers for the Guttmacher Institute surveyed 1,800 males and females aged 18-29, they found that more than half of young men and a quarter of young women proved to show little knowledge of contraceptive services.
